What is the difference between Structural Dynamics Engineer vs Structural Engineer?

AspectStructural Dynamics EngineerStructural Engineer
Required CredentialsBachelor's or Master's in Civil/Structural Engineering; often includes coursework in dynamics and vibrationsBachelor's or Master's in Civil/Structural Engineering; focus on design and analysis
Work EnvironmentSpecialized analysis, simulations, and testing related to dynamic behavior of structuresDesign, analysis, and inspection of buildings and infrastructure
Industry UsageUsed in projects requiring dynamic analysis, such as earthquake or wind load assessmentsUsed broadly across construction, infrastructure, and building projects

The main difference is that a Structural Dynamics Engineer specializes in analyzing how structures respond to dynamic forces like earthquakes and wind, while a Structural Engineer focuses on the overall design and safety of structures. Both roles require similar educational backgrounds but differ in their focus areas and project types.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a structural dynamics engineer?

To thrive as a Structural Dynamics Engineer, you need a strong background in mechanical or civil engineering, with expertise in vibration analysis, structural mechanics, and typically a relevant engineering degree. Familiarity with simulation tools like ANSYS, MATLAB, and finite element analysis (FEA) software, as well as knowledge of relevant industry standards, is crucial. Strong problem-solving skills, attention to detail, and effective communication help you collaborate with multidisciplinary teams and explain complex concepts to stakeholders. Mastery of these skills enables accurate prediction and mitigation of structural responses, ensuring safety and reliability in engineering projects.

What is a structural dynamics engineer?

Structural dynamics engineers are professionals who analyze and design structures to withstand dynamic loads, such as vibrations, earthquakes, wind, and other time-dependent forces. They use advanced mathematical models and simulations to predict how structures like buildings, bridges, aircraft, and vehicles will respond to these forces. Their work ensures that structures are safe, efficient, and meet regulatory standards for dynamic performance.

Job description

Responsibilities
  • Perform technical responsibilities required of a Structural Engineer II/III
  • Mentor less experienced engineers
  • Contribute to client meetings as department representative
  • Demonstrate familiarity with Valdes A&E structural engineering work practices
  • Prepare AutoCAD and Revit drawings
  • Demonstrate familiarity and expertise in using Revit and Navisworks in 3D modeling
  • Prepare structural scopes of work and material take-offs
  • Develop a refined understanding of construction drawings such as Plans, Sections, Details, and Piping Isometrics
  • Develop familiarity and expertise with prevalent structural industry codes, standards, and practices (i.e. AISC, ACI, ASCE 7, IBC, etc.)
  • Demonstrate understanding of client standards and specifications
  • Review steel fabricator, concrete rebar, and other vendor shop drawings and submittals
  • Perform and document simple structural calculations under the guidance of a more senior colleague
  • Demonstrate proficiency in using Risa 3D, PROFIS, MathCAD, and other software commonly used in the department
  • Demonstrate continuous technical improvement and desire to sit for the structural engineer (SE) exam
  • Verify field conditions, constructability of designs, and assist in resolving problems during field construction

Qualifications
  • Bachelor's Degree or higher in Civil or Structural Engineering
  • 3-5 years of experience working as a Structural Engineer
  • Refined understanding of statics, dynamics, steel design, and concrete design
  • Basic technical report writing skills
  • Basic 2D and/or 3D CAD expertise
  • Basic Microsoft Office expertise
  • Must possess exceptional interpersonal and organizational skills
